Style #4
|
||||
==============================
|
||||
|
||||
Constraints:
|
||||
|
||||
- Larger problem decomposed in functional abstractions. Functions, according to Mathematics, are relations from inputs to outputs.
|
||||
- Larger problem solved as a pipeline of function applications
|
||||
|
||||
Possible names:
|
||||
|
||||
- Functional
|
||||
- Pipeline

import sys, re, operator, string
|
||||
|
||||
#
|
||||
# The functions
|
||||
#
|
||||
def read_file(path_to_file):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Takes a path to a file and returns the entire
|
||||
contents of the file as a string
|
||||
"""
|
||||
f = open(path_to_file)
|
||||
data = f.read()
|
||||
f.close()
|
||||
return data
|
||||
|
||||
def filter_chars(str_data):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Takes a string and returns a copy with all nonalphanumeric
|
||||
chars replaced by white space
|
||||
"""
|
||||
pattern = re.compile('[\W_]+')
|
||||
return pattern.sub(' ', str_data)
|
||||
|
||||
def normalize(str_data):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Takes a string and returns a copy with all chars in lower case
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return str_data.lower()
|
||||
|
||||
def scan(str_data):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Takes a string and scans for words, returning
|
||||
a list of words.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return str_data.split()
|
||||
|
||||
def remove_stop_words(word_list):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Takes a list of words and returns a copy with all stop
|
||||
words removed
|
||||
"""
|
||||
f = open('../stop_words.txt')
|
||||
stop_words = f.read().split(',')
|
||||
f.close()
|
||||
# add single-letter words
|
||||
stop_words.extend(list(string.ascii_lowercase))
|
||||
return [w for w in word_list if not w in stop_words]
|
||||
|
||||
def frequencies(word_list):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Takes a list of words and returns a dictionary associating
|
||||
words with frequencies of occurrence
|
||||
"""
|
||||
word_freqs = {}
|
||||
for w in word_list:
|
||||
if w in word_freqs:
|
||||
word_freqs[w] += 1
|
||||
else:
|
||||
word_freqs[w] = 1
|
||||
return word_freqs
|
||||
|
||||
def sort(word_freq):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Takes a dictionary of words and their frequencies
|
||||
and returns a list of pairs where the entries are
|
||||
sorted by frequency
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return sorted(word_freq.iteritems(), key=operator.itemgetter(1), reverse=True)
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
#
|
||||
# The main function
|
||||
#
|
||||
word_freqs = sort(frequencies(remove_stop_words(scan(normalize(filter_chars(read_file(sys.argv[1])))))))
|
||||
|
||||
for tf in word_freqs[0:25]:
|
||||
print tf[0], ' - ', tf[1]
